Hydrangea Pruning Questions
When is the best time to prune hydrangeas? Pruning is typically done in late winter or early spring before new growth begins.
How much should I prune hydrangeas? Remove dead or damaged stems and cut back to shape the plant, avoiding heavy pruning that can reduce blooms.
Can all hydrangea varieties be pruned the same way? No, pruning methods vary depending on the type of hydrangea, such as mophead or paniculata.
Why is proper pruning important for hydrangeas? Proper pruning encourages healthy growth, improves flowering, and maintains the plant’s shape.
